Transaction fbbc74d73a3e14c8855fa33a36651a4c825f7204b253a92279507a76243ca05c
1 Input
3 Outputs
- fbbc74d73a3e14c8855fa33a36651a4c825f7204b253a92279507a76243ca05c:0
- fbbc74d73a3e14c8855fa33a36651a4c825f7204b253a92279507a76243ca05c:1
- fbbc74d73a3e14c8855fa33a36651a4c825f7204b253a92279507a76243ca05c:2
value 6650693
address 1H9LR1tkgRQPi3QEeNo94wJfmCgphGeqwp
value 42084805
address 3MrgU4obRnTdH8KbwVzA61TVrThfPKXMLD
value 785661757
address 3JdY9HmGoZFxFPTgPj1TDBdyTEdfKo2Rbx